As a Winding Technician, you're the first and last hands on every core & coil we rewind. The transformers you rebuild have powered American factories and communities for decades. Your job is to fit them with new coils and put them back in service for decades more.

This is not an assembly-line factory job. The work runs from heavy and mechanical to fine and technical. You cut the lid off each transformer, remove and disassemble the transformer's core & coil (the heart of the machine), and take the measurements our winders need to wind new coils just across the shop. When the coils come back, you stack in thousands of pounds of core steel, insulate and set the head frame, weld on aluminum/copper bus, and wire up the complete unit, ready for the next stage of production.

This is a career, not a gig. You'll learn a skilled trade, working on a team that takes pride in doing the job right, for an employer who values your work ethic, character, and stable lifestyle. You'll also work with our production team on electrical testing, component function and installation, and the full reconditioning process, learning the transformer inside and out.
